What is OPD Cover in Health Plans?
To understand What is OPD cover in health plans?, first let’s understand OPD.
OPD stands for Out-Patient Department.
It refers to medical consultations, tests, or treatments where you visit a doctor or clinic but are not admitted to the hospital.
OPD vs Hospitalization
| Feature | OPD | Hospitalization |
|---|---|---|
| Admission Required | ❌ No | ✅ Yes |
| Examples | Doctor visits, blood tests, X-rays | Surgery, ICU stay |
| Frequency | Frequent | Rare |
What Expenses Are Covered Under OPD?
Depending on the plan, OPD cover may include:
- Doctor consultation coverage
- Diagnostic benefits (blood tests, scans, radiology)
- Pharmacy discounts
- Teleconsultations
- Mental health consultations

OPD Reimbursement vs Cashless OPD
One important part of understanding What is OPD cover in health plans? is knowing how claims work.
There are two common models:
1. OPD Reimbursement
You pay the doctor first.
Later, you submit bills to the insurer.
The company processes and reimburses approved amounts.
2. Cashless OPD
You visit a network doctor.
No upfront payment (or minimal payment).
The insurer settles the bill directly.
Comparison Table
| Feature | Reimbursement | Cashless OPD |
|---|---|---|
| Upfront Payment | Required | Not required |
| Claim Process | Manual | Seamless |
| Processing Time | Few days to weeks | Immediate |
| Convenience | Moderate | High |
Cashless OPD is growing in popularity because it reduces paperwork and stress.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. What is OPD cover in health plans?
OPD cover in health plans refers to insurance benefits that pay for outpatient treatments like doctor consultations, diagnostics, and medicines without hospitalization.
2. Does OPD cover include medicines?
Some plans offer pharmacy discounts or limited reimbursement. Always check policy terms.
3. Is cashless OPD better than reimbursement?
Yes, cashless OPD is usually more convenient because you don’t pay upfront.
4. Can family members use OPD benefits?
Yes, family OPD plans typically allow multiple members to use consultation and diagnostic benefits.
5. Is OPD cover regulated in India?
Yes, health insurance policies follow guidelines under IRDAI regulations.
